  • Publication number: 20240403531
    Abstract: A tool is disclosed that automatically generates constraints for the placement of network elements, which can be understood by the backend tools that follow the constraints. The tool also constrains the placement within given bounds results in faster runtimes in the backend tools. Further, the tool automatically inserts additional elements into the topology to help with timing closure in downstream or backend tools. Additionally, the tool provides real-time feedback on wire congestion to the user during editing. The tool also implements a machine learning model that is trained and receives feedback for solutions provided to further train the model. The tool also includes the ability to use feedback to train a machine learning model for automated and assisted topology analysis and synthesis. The tool generates physical implementation guidance, which is during physical implementation of the synthesized NoC.
